In light of the COVID-19 pandemic, Jamaica Carnival directors, have decided to postpone Carnival in Jamaica 2020 Road Marches to October 2020.

The announcement was made by Kamal Bankay, Chairman of Carnival in Jamaica and Minister of Tourism Edmund Bartlett at a press conference this morning (Fri).

Bankay indicated that costumes and other items linked to carnival bands will still be valid.
